Langley City, Canada
20230 Fraser Hwy
N/A
+16048386600
They have some really cool equipment for surveillance and camera's along with other items that may be useful in the Security Industry and also local law enforcement agencies.
like
May the best prepared win...!
Deli
The best companies in the category 'Deli'